区块链是一种分布式账本技术,它可以用来记录交易历史并保持数据的完整性和安全性。由于区块链的去中心化特性,它可以提供一个安全、可靠而又具有透明度的系统。在这种系统中,使用不同的版本记录历史记录。然而,如何评估这些不同版本的历史记录?
为了解决这个问题,区块链开发者采用了一种新的算法——共识机制(Consensus Mechanism)。这种机制可以帮助区块链系统对不同版本的历史记录进行评分。
共识机制是一种分布式协议,它能够帮助整个网络中所有节点之间保持一致性。它也是一个难度调整机制,用来使整个区块链系统保持一个固定的出块速度。在这里,所有节点都会根据不同版本的历史记录来评估出块速度。如果出块速度太快或太慢,就会对整个区块链的正常工作造成影响。
因此,共识机制是一个重要的工具,能够帮助区块链对不同版本历史记录进行评分。例如,在比特币中使用的工作量证明协议(Proof-of-Work Protocols)就是一个典型的共识机制。在这个协议中,所有凭证都会根据既定的难度条件来生成新的区块。新生成的区块会根据不同版本历史记录来进行评分;如果凭证者生成了正确的新区块(而不是无效或无意义的新区块)就会得到奖励。
此外,在不同版本历史记录上也使用了一些其他的共识协议。例如在以太坊中使用的工作量例子协议(Proof-of-Stake Protocols)和 Delegated Proof-of-Stake Protocols (DPoS)都是特定情况下使用的共识协议。在这些协议中也存在对不同版本历史记录进行评分的功能。
总之,共识机制是一个重要而强大的工具:它能够帮助区块链对不同版本历史记录进行评分、保护整体系统并支撑正常工作流程。通过使用这些协议来对历史记录进行评估、促进正常出块速度并保障整体安全性、正直性、透明度以及一直都是区块链开发者努力相向考察的方向之一。